Summary

The New Orleans Saints host the Jacksonville Jaguars in their preseason opener at the Superdome on Saturday afternoon. Most starters for both teams will not participate, which shifts focus to younger players across several key positions. Saints will look to assess their offensive line depth without Dillon Radunz, while the wide receiver corps undergoes evaluation with rookies Barion Brown and Bryce Lance expected to feature prominently. The linebacker position faces scrutiny after Demario Davis's departure, and the Saints aim to improve their defensive line, with the return of Vernon Broughton from injury. The kicker competition remains tight as both Charlie Smyth and Tanner Brown have struggled during training camp.
